Banfora's Automotive & Agricultural Infrastructure Dynamics

Banfora, positioned as one of Burkina Faso's most critical agricultural and regional industrial hubs, demands specialized engineering designs for hydraulic brake configurations. Hosting extensive agro-processing industries—such as the sugar operations of SN SOSUCO and nearby cotton networks—the local transport framework relies heavily on light trucks, utility logistics fleets, agricultural machinery, and high-frequency motorcycle transport.

These operations run under severe environmental duress. High ambient temperatures exceeding 40°C, combined with pervasive fine dust and mud during the wet season, rapidly degrade conventional EPDM rubber brake lines. Without superior protective braiding, external abrasion and heat-induced volumetric expansion cause soft pedal response, dangerous stopping distances, and catastrophic hydraulic failure.

Macro Sourcing Strategy: Evaluating Brake Hose Suppliers

A technical guide for industrial supply chains sourcing braking equipment for high-stress and harsh environment distribution.

1. Material Composition Analysis

Always verify the core tube polymer matrix. For high-temperature resilience, specify PTFE (Polytetrafluoroethylene) rather than generic polyamides. PTFE withstands temperatures up to 260°C and maintains structural integrity when exposed to glycol-based DOT 3, DOT 4, and DOT 5.1 fluids without swelling.

2. Whipping & Tensile Performance

Heavy machinery operating on unpaved roads generates extreme vibrational cycles. Demand tensile test verification (minimum pull-off strength exceeding 1500 N). Zizel utilizes custom tensiometers to calibrate structural crimping junctions, preventing fluid blowout under sudden peak pressure events.

3. Environmental & Salt Degradation

In coastal or Sahelian microclimates where corrosive dust and seasonal humidity degrade metal components, specify components with a protective polymer sheath (PVC or PU) over the stainless steel braid. Zizel conducts salt spray testing up to 72 hours to ensure long-lasting structural protection.

Q: Why is PTFE superior to standard EPDM rubber lines in West African climates like Banfora?
A: PTFE features superior thermal threshold stability up to 260°C and does not degrade or dry out when exposed to high ozone levels or extreme UV rays. Additionally, PTFE is chemically inert, eliminating fluid moisture absorption and preventing the structural softening common with rubber hoses under high ambient heat.
